List Company Subsidiaries

Returns all subsidiary accounts on lower hierarchy layers, based on the Company account specified.

Query parameters

offsetintegerOptionalDefaults to 0

The number of results to skip before returning the first result. If left blank, this defaults to 0.

limitintegerOptionalDefaults to 10

Determines the number of records to return per page. If left blank, this defaults to 10.

Response

OK The `subsidiaries` array in the response includes nested `subsidiaries` arrays if a child account has its own subsidiaries. The array also includes nested `subsidiaries` arrays for each Company with its own subsidiaries. For example, if the Company in question is above 2 layers of Account Hierarchy, its direct subsidiaries will also include `subsidiaries` arrays for their child accounts.
